SAINT PETER AND COMPANIONS, MARTYRS At Nicomedia, Saint Peter (Petrus Cubicularius), chamberlain to the emperor Diocletian, the priest Migdonius, another Migdonius, Euticius ( Eunenus ), Maxima (Maximus), the virgin Donata (Domna), Ruginus, Marius, Smaragdus, Hilarius, Evengulus (Vingelosinus), Quirinus, Mareasus, Nestor, Eugenius, Dorotheus, Gorgonius and Matulus (Marulus) all attained the martyrdom in the year 302. Several of these were imperial officials. The Emperor Diocletian had idols carried into his palace and the Christians brought before them to sacrifice to them. Since they refused, he had some beaten with ox sinews and lead butts, others hung up and mauled, still others skinned. Everyone remained firm in the faith. Dorotheus and Gorgonius are also venerated by the Greeks (on September 9). The Roman Martyrology * just mentions Saint Peter on March 12, but none of his Companions...
